Abstract
A vehicle occupant protection apparatus () has an inflatable occupant protection device () and a support member () having a vent opening (). A vent member () is associated with the vent opening (). A tether () extends between the protection device () and the vent member (). The vent member () is initially in a first condition closing the vent opening (). The vent member () is moved to a second condition spaced apart from the vent opening () and enabling fluid flow through the vent opening () upon initial inflation of the protection device (). The vent member () is moved from the second condition back toward the first condition by tension in the tether () that results from inflation of the protection device () away from the support member () by more than a predetermined distance.
